In photoelasticity,the experiment gives only the difference of principal stresses and their directions. In order to obtain three plane stress components,the supplementary equations are required. Using oblique incidence method one can obtain the three plane stress components. Considering the experimental data is not accurate,multi-angle oblique incidence established nonlinear overdetermined equations are used to calculate stress components. Conventional method for solving nonlinear overdetermined equations is difficult,new particle swarm optimization algorithms are proposed for oblique incidence stress separation. Demonstration of the method on disc under diametral compression is performed using computer simulation. The method is effective and simple for stress separation,providing whole field stress components.
